Azalea City Golf Course

Azalea City Golf Course in Mobile, Alabama has been around since 1957 and was designed by Robert B. Harris. It's a reasonably priced course, with a $15 fee during weekdays and weekends. If you're an early riser, you'll be pleased to know that the first tee time is at 7:00 AM. With 18 holes and a par of 72, it offers a decent challenge. The course is open all year, so you can tee off whenever you like. The greens are Bent Grass, while the fairways are Bermuda Grass, providing a diverse playing surface. One thing to note is that the number of bunkers isn't mentioned explicitly, but they are a part of the course. However, fivesome golf groups are not allowed. If you enjoy a course with a variety of challenges and a moderate price, Azalea City Golf Course might be a great choice for your next round.

Gulf Pines Golf Course

Gulf Pines Golf Course, established in 1970 and designed by Marv Ginn, is a hidden gem tucked away in the beautiful city of Mobile, Alabama. Offering a great golfing experience at an affordable price, the course charges $14 for weekend play and $12 for weekdays. Early birds can tee off as early as 6:30 AM, ensuring maximum enjoyment of the course. With 18 challenging holes and a par of 71, this course is perfect for both novice and experienced golfers. The Bermuda Grass, which covers both the greens and fairways, adds to the overall appeal of the course. Although the greens are aerated at various times throughout the year, the course still offers a satisfying golfing experience. It's worth noting that Gulf Pines Golf Course allows fivesome golf groups, making it an ideal destination for those who like to play with a larger party. Additionally, the course features 20 bunkers in strategic locations, adding an extra touch of excitement to your game. Overall, Gulf Pines Golf Course is a well-maintained and reasonably priced option for golf enthusiasts looking to test their skills in Mobile, Alabama.

Crossings Course at Robert Trent Jones Golf Trail at Magnolia Grove

The Crossings Course at the Robert Trent Jones Golf Trail at Magnolia Grove in Mobile, Alabama is a gem for golfers looking for a challenging yet enjoyable round. Designed by the legendary Robert Trent Jones, Sr. in 1992, this 54-hole course offers an excellent golf experience. With tee times starting as early as 7:00 AM, players can enjoy an early morning round on the Bermuda Grass fairways and greens. The course is open all year round, allowing golfers to enjoy a round at their own convenience. If you're planning to play on weekends or weekdays, the green fee is $72, which is quite reasonable considering the quality of the course. However, it's worth noting that the greens are typically aerated in June and July, so keep that in mind when planning your visit. The course boasts a total of 10 bunkers, ensuring that you'll need to bring your A-game to navigate those tricky hazards. One thing to keep in mind is that fivesome golf groups are not allowed, so plan accordingly if you have a larger group. Overall, the Crossings Course at the Robert Trent Jones Golf Trail at Magnolia Grove is a fantastic choice for golfers seeking a beautiful and well-maintained course.

Spring Hill College Golf Course

Spring Hill College Golf Course in Mobile, Alabama is a charming course that has been around since 1930. Designed by T.A. Buckhaults, this 18-hole course offers a classic golfing experience. The green fees are reasonably priced at $34 on weekends and $29 on weekdays, making it accessible for both casual and avid golfers. With an earliest tee time at 7:00 AM, you can start your day early and enjoy the serene beauty of the course. The par 72 layout provides a good challenge for golfers of all skill levels. The course features Tifdwarf Grass greens and Bermuda Grass fairways, ensuring a well-maintained playing surface. Although the number of bunkers is not specified, it is worth mentioning that they exist on the course. So, if you enjoy strategizing your way out of sandy traps, you'll find plenty of opportunities. Whether you're a solo player or part of a fivesome group, Spring Hill College Golf Course offers a memorable golfing experience that is open all year round.

Linksman Golf Club

Linksman Golf Club in Mobile, Alabama, is a fantastic option for golfers looking for a challenging yet affordable course. Built in 1972 and designed by Ralph Sharp, this 18-hole course offers a diverse range of holes that will test your skills. With a par of 72, it provides a balanced and exciting game for players of all levels. The course is open all year, allowing you to enjoy a round any time you please. The Bermuda Grass greens and fairways ensure a smooth and well-maintained playing surface, although be aware that the greens are typically aerated in May and September. At just $15 to play on both weekends and weekdays, this course offers exceptional value for your money. Additionally, the earliest tee time of 7:00 AM allows you to start your day bright and early. Whether you're golfing alone, with a few buddies, or even a fivesome, you'll have a great time navigating the 31-40 bunkers scattered strategically across the course. Overall, Linksman Golf Club is a hidden gem in Mobile, offering an enjoyable and affordable golfing experience that shouldn't be missed.

Falls Course at Robert Trent Jones Golf Trail at Magnolia Grove

Located in Mobile, Alabama, the Falls Course at Robert Trent Jones Golf Trail at Magnolia Grove is a classic golf destination that offers a challenging and memorable experience. Designed by the renowned Robert Trent Jones, Sr. in 1992, this 54-hole course is a must-visit for golf enthusiasts. With a par of 72, the course provides a well-rounded test of skill and strategy. Open all year, golfers have the opportunity to enjoy its beautiful Bermuda Grass greens and fairways. While the course does have 31-40 bunkers strategically placed throughout, making it a fair challenge, it’s important to note that fivesome golf groups are not allowed. Tee times begin as early as 7:00 AM, offering players a chance to start their day off right. With green fees priced at $72 for both weekends and weekdays, the Falls Course is a worthwhile investment for a quality round of golf. However, it's worth noting that June and July are typically when the greens undergo aeration. So, if you're particular about the quality of the greens, it may be best to plan your visit accordingly. Overall, the Falls Course at Magnolia Grove is a beautiful and well-maintained course that provides a challenging yet enjoyable experience for golfers of all levels.
